Advantages and Disadvantages of Using Different Soil Tillage ...

Advantages and Disadvantages of Using Different Soil Tillage ...

Farmers must keep in mind the advantage and disadvantages of tillage equipment before they plan to use any.  The main advantage of conservation tillage is to reduce soil erosion due to wind and water significantly. Additional advantages include minimizing labour and fuel requirements.

However, increased dependency may be employed on herbicides with the use of certain conservation tillage systems. Here we have mentioned the advantages and disadvantages of using different types of tillage equipment &#;

Advantages

  • It is suitable equipment to use in dry and trashy areas.
  • Allows farmers to prepare a well-tilled seedbed
  • Easily mixes and turns the soil.

Disadvantages

  • Can cause major soil erosion
  • High loss in soil moisture.
  • Labour and fuel cost is high.
  • Disc Harrow

Advantages

  • Reduces soil erosion with more residue.
  • Best suitable to prepare a seedbed in well-drained soils.
  • Allows good incorporation of manure and seeds.

Disadvantages

  • In some cases causes little erosion with more operations.
  • High loss in soil moisture.
  • Modifies soil structure completely.
  • Wet soil becomes compacts.
  • No-till

Advantages

  • Excellent control on soil erosion.
  • Preserves moisture in the soil.
  • Minimizes labour and fuel costs.
  • Helps in building soil structure and health.      

Disadvantages

  • Increases dependency on herbicides and pesticides.
  • Slow warming of soil on poorly drained soils.

Advantages

  • Reduces fuel expense significantly.
  • A Farmer can prepare the soil with a rotavator immediately after harvesting.
  • Soil can be prepared smoothly, quickly and efficiently.
  • Appropriate to use in dry as well as wet soil cultivation.

Disadvantages

  • Sometimes can cause crop diseases to be locked in surface residues.
  • Needs huge power from tractors.

Rotary Tillers: Agriculture Advantages

Rotary Tillers are machines used for both primary and secondary Tillage for cultivating the soil. They use a series of blades that eliminate weeds, relieve compaction, as it mixes and levels the soil. This agricultural equipment is very powerful and is used for seedbed preparation. It&#;s are Primary and secondary tillage as they break up, churns and aerates the soil prior to planting. This improves drainage and makes your ground ideal for growing vegetables and row crops. 

These machines are ideal for cash crop farmers who are looking to bury and incorporate crop residues and trash efficiently and quickly between harvesting and planting. 

Benefits Of Rotary Tillers 

  • Rotary tillers allow the preparation of the soil without using a large amount of labour. It&#;s essential to ensure your soil is properly prepared. Turning your soil gives you the maximum amount of nutrients for your plants. The better your soil structure, the bigger the crops you yield. 

  • There are a large variety of model sizes to suit any tractor.

  • Rotary Tillers are suitable to use in dry and wetland cultivation/ 

  • They can loosen and aerate soil up to 10-15cm in depth

 

Application of Rotary Tillers 

Chopping and mixing- rotary tillers are ideal for chopping and mixing crops like maize, tobacco, sugarcane, cotton and rice. The trash mixes uniformly and through the soil adds valuable humus to the soil. 

Tilling and planting- many rotary tillers can be equipped with a toolbar mounted planter for towing a planter for tillage and planting. Rearraging a rotary tillers blades on the rotor shaft allows you to use the machine to strip-tillage your seedbed. 

Fertiliser and chemicals &#; the mixing action of the machine is ideal for the incorporation of fertiliser after spreading. 

Weed control&#; Rotary hoes provide effective weed control while tilling and incorporate the green manure into the soil.

 

Choosing The Right Rotary Tillers 

This machine comes in different sizes for different applications. Gardens and small allotments require smaller tillers. Larger ones are more commonly used on larger areas of land, vegetable patches and fields. Their gearboxes and blade sizes desiged differently for light or more heavy-dutry work. Lighter machines are usually more economical but won&#;t stand up to more demanding tasks.
